Login  |  Register
Automatic Backlinks Banner

4 Star Hotels in Chandigarh

The Bella Vista Hotel is an appreciable choice for a comfortable stay if you are to pick from among the 4 Star Hotels in Chandigarh. The accommodation can be hassle-free and enjoyable which is atypical when you travel.
Average rating: 0 (0 votes)
You must be logged in to leave a rating.